Study Summary

This is a single-center cross-sectional imaging and correlative biomarker study in patients with Squamous Cell Carcinoma of the Head and Neck (SCCHN). Cohort 1 will be patients with unresectable or metastatic SCCHN cancer receiving standard of care (SOC) anti-PD-1 treatment and Cohort 2 will be neoadjuvant study participants who will receive one dose of anti-PD-1 treatment prior to tumor resection or radiation. Blood sampling and tissue biopsies will be collected from both cohorts and both cohorts will undergo two whole body PET(Positron Emission Tomography)/CT(Computed Tomography) imaging with \[18F\]F-AraG. First scan prior to initiating anti-PD-1 treatment and second scan post initiation of anti-PD-1 treatment in Cohort 1 and prior to tumor resection or radiation in Cohort 2

Primary Outcome

Assess whether \[18F\]F-AraG accumulation at the site of inflammation can be used for noninvasive imaging and assessment of T cell activation and expansion in the tumor microenvironment. Specifically, we will be assessing if there is a correlation between an increase in the imaging signal and an increase in T cell activation (measured directly from the T cells obtained from biopsy specimens).

Interventions

  • DRUG [18F]F-AraG PET Scan, baseline + post anti-PD-1 therapy.
